We purchase from a company call jr286 and branded custom sportswear. The former does non team acceories (headbands, gloves, lanyards etc etc) and the latter does non sideline team apparel, inflatables and bags, both for Nike (nike lecenses them to produce this stuff) both have had backlog orders since summer. We have about 10000 backpacks for about 60 different college teams that have have had their ship date pushed back every month since agust...
Tl;dr: supply chain is fuqed
